When winter weather hits, Oklahoma Turnpike Authority (OTA) snow and tow plows aren’t far behind. OTA’s concern for driver safety is growing, as more snow plows are hit by motorists who become distracted or impatient when following.

OTA encourages you to follow these tips if you find yourself behind a snowplow:

1. Stay 250 feet behind the snow plow.

2. Resist the urge to pass.

3. Be patient – take advantage of the cleared path.

Additionally, OTA offers a road condition hotline at 1-877-403-7623, for motorists to call ahead of traveling on Oklahoma’s turnpikes. Drive aware, arrive alive!
